Confirm the fit first
Your pet should have enough room to settle comfortably without being able to slip out of the carrier. Check the current weight and size limits and compare them with your pet’s measurements.
Practice before a real trip
Leave the carrier open at home with familiar bedding or a reward nearby. Short, calm practice sessions can help your pet associate the carrier with routine rather than only vet visits or stressful travel.
Check ventilation and security
Make sure air panels are unobstructed and every zipper, clip, leash tether, or buckle is working correctly. Never rely on an interior tether as a substitute for a properly fitted harness.
Pay attention to temperature
Carriers can warm quickly in sun, vehicles, or crowded spaces. Provide breaks, fresh water when appropriate, and never leave a pet unattended in a parked vehicle.
Match the carrier to the activity
A backpack used for a walk has different demands than an airline carrier or car crate. Check transportation rules and manufacturer guidance before traveling.
